What Does It Mean When A Dog's Nose Is Dry And Crusty?

Dry and crusty nose in dogs is usually harmless, but it's recommended to consult a vet to rule out any potential health issues.

Environmental Factors

Dry and crusty nose in dogs can be caused by environmental factors like sun or wind exposure. Consult a vet for proper evaluation and care.

Allergies

Another reason why your dog’s nose may be dry and crusty is allergies. Many dog breeds are allergic to a variety of things, including food, pollen, and certain chemicals.

Infections

Dry and crusty nose accompanied by nasal seepage may indicate infection in dogs. Seek veterinary care for proper diagnosis and treatment.

Autoimmune Diseases

Autoimmune diseases like pemphigus can cause dryness in a dog's nose. Prompt veterinary care is essential for diagnosis and treatment.

Brachycephalic Breeds

Flat-nosed breeds like Bull Mastiffs, Boxers, and Bulldogs can experience dryness on their noses due to breathing difficulties.

Trauma

Facial trauma can result in dryness and crustiness on one side of a dog's nose due to swelling and inflammation.

Something Stuck in the Nose

Foreign objects stuck in a dog's nostril can cause dryness on that side of the nose due to irritation and obstruction.
